Dmitri Shepilov

Dmitri trofimovich Shepilov (Russian: Дмитрий Трофимович Шепилов; * 23 Oktoberjul / 5 November 1905greg in Ashgabat, Russian Empire, today Turkmenistan, .. † 18 August 1995 in Moscow ) was a Soviet politician and Minister of Foreign Affairs 1956 until 1957.

Life

Shepilov on July 12, 1955 Member of the Central Committee of the CPSU and on February 27, 1956 candidate for the Politburo. On 1 June 1956 he was the successor of the Soviet Foreign Minister Molotov. He was considered a close associate of Khrushchev and is said to have contributed to the policies of the new opening to the West. On July 29, 1957 Shepilov was excluded after an attempted coup against Khrushchev together with Molotov, Kaganovich and Malenkov from the Politburo. His successor as Foreign Minister Gromyko was his former deputy.
